Graphics Mill is an advanced image processing library. It allows loading/saving images (JPEG, PNG, GIF, TIFF, EPS, PDF, EPS, PSD, IDML and others) in various bitmap formats (RGB, CMYK, 8 and 16-bit per channel), managing metadata (EXIF, IPTC, XMP, Adobe Resources), manipulating image channels and pixels, applying operations on images (crop, resize, rotate, flip), drawing bitmap and vector elements, single and multiline text (including artistic effects and text line distortions),  converting colors with ICC profiles, adjust color/tone/brightness/contrasts and apply image filters.  

IMPORTANT: This version is targeted for x64 environment. For x86 applications, please use the package named Graphics Mill Core (x86).

Aurigma.GraphicsMill.Templates.x64

Graphics Mill Templates is a library which allows loading Adobe Photoshop (PSD) files as templates or mockups, personalize them by replacing the content of its layers (text and images) and export results to JPEG, TIFF, PDF or EPS format. For example, it can be used for variable data printing applications (e.g. to generate printing product based on templates) or create pseudo-3D preview images using Smart Objects for such goods like bottles, cups, t-shirts, etc. The library is based on the Graphics Mill imaging SDK. Aurigma.GraphicsMill.WinControls.x64

Graphics Mill Windows Controls is a set of Windows Forms controls which helps you creating image processing user interface in desktop applications. Bitmap Viewer control displays a bitmap on the screen with zoom, scroll and crop functionality. Vector Objects module allows working with composite images consisting of multiple elements such as bitmaps, texts and vector data. Thumbnail List View control display a collection of images no matter if they are stored in a file system or memory.
